fix keymaps, find hidden files with telescope

This commit is contained in:
Patrick Neff 2024-08-08 13:00:55 +02:00
parent df70ebbe18
commit cf122f3218
5 changed files with 21 additions and 30 deletions

View File

@ -1,19 +1,5 @@
_: { _: {
keymaps = [ keymaps = [
{
key = "<leader>e";
action = "<cmd>Neotree toggle<CR>";
options = {
silent = true;
};
}
{
key = "<leader>ff";
action = "<cmd>Telescope find_files<CR>";
options = {
silent = true;
};
}
{ {
key = "<Space>"; key = "<Space>";
action = "<Nop>"; action = "<Nop>";

View File

@ -133,12 +133,6 @@ in {
local actions = require("telescope.actions") local actions = require("telescope.actions")
local action_state = require("telescope.actions.state") local action_state = require("telescope.actions.state")
local pickers = require("telescope.pickers")
local finders = require("telescope.finders")
local conf = require("telescope.config").values
local actions = require("telescope.actions")
local action_state = require("telescope.actions.state")
function get_program() function get_program()
return coroutine.create(function(coro) return coroutine.create(function(coro)
local opts = {} local opts = {}

View File

@ -39,9 +39,18 @@
}; };
filesystem = { filesystem = {
filtered_items = { filtered_items = {
hide_by_pattern = ["*_templ.go"]; hide_by_pattern = [ "*_templ.go" ];
}; };
}; };
}; };
}; };
keymaps = [
{
key = "<leader>e";
action = "<cmd>Neotree toggle<CR>";
options = {
silent = true;
};
}
];
} }

View File

@ -12,6 +12,7 @@
}; };
formatting = { formatting = {
phpcbf.enable = true; phpcbf.enable = true;
goimports.enable = true;
}; };
}; };
}; };

View File

@ -5,6 +5,7 @@
"<leader>fg" = "live_grep"; "<leader>fg" = "live_grep";
"<leader>fb" = "buffers"; "<leader>fb" = "buffers";
"<leader>fo" = "oldfiles"; "<leader>fo" = "oldfiles";
"<leader>fF" = "find_files";
"<leader>ff" = { "<leader>ff" = {
action = "git_files"; action = "git_files";
options = { options = {
@ -17,6 +18,11 @@
ui-select.enable = true; ui-select.enable = true;
}; };
settings = { settings = {
pickers = {
find_files = {
find_command = [ "rg" "--no-ignore" "--files" "--hidden" "--glob" "!**/.git/*" "--glob" "!**/.direnv/*" ];
};
};
defaults = { defaults = {
prompt_prefix = " 󰍉 "; prompt_prefix = " 󰍉 ";
selection_caret = " "; selection_caret = " ";
@ -38,17 +44,12 @@
height = 0.80; height = 0.80;
preview_cutoff = 120; preview_cutoff = 120;
}; };
file_ignore_patterns = ["node_modules" "vendor"]; file_ignore_patterns = [ "node_modules" "vendor" ];
path_display = ["truncate"]; path_display = [ "truncate" ];
winblend = 3; winblend = 3;
border = {}; border = { };
borderchars = [" " " " " " " " " " " " " " " "]; borderchars = [ " " " " " " " " " " " " " " " " ];
color_devicons = true; color_devicons = true;
pickers = {
find_files = {
find_command = ["rg" "--files" "--hidden" "--glob" "!**/.git/*"];
};
};
mappings = { mappings = {
i = { i = {
"<esc>" = { "<esc>" = {